This charming cottage on three acres is located 8 miles south of Middleburg near the picturesque village of The Plains, VA. We are in the heart of Hunt Country (wine and horse country) in the foothills of the Appalachians, 50 miles west of DC on 66. The home is perfect for a quiet getaway. Renovated thoughtfully, it retains its charm and 19th-century stone foundation. The fully equipped kitchen/dining room has an open plan while the sunroom opens to a large deck overlooking the expansive lawn. We have satellite tv in the living room and a smart TV upstairs. We have unlimited high-speed internet through T-mobile.
Three of the beds are trundles that pull out from the twin beds (all real mattresses). The one downstairs is a pop-up. The location of the property is ideal for hiking (close to the Appalachian Trail), biking, and horseback riding. Artists will appreciate the rolling hills, historic architecture, and miles of old stone fences. Enjoy the many surrounding wineries, antiquing, orchards, and fine dining establishments nearby, or pack a picnic (we provide a basket and blanket) and enjoy "Twilight Polo" up close every Saturday evening throughout the summer in The Plains' own Great Meadow where the VA Cup steeplechases are held annually. The farmer's market in The Plains is each Sunday from spring to fall. Boarding and horseback riding lessons are possible across the road at Madcap Farm. Horses neighing or roosters crowing in the distance will remind you that it is time to relax and take in the country air.
